Operations managers, HR teams, project leads, and anyone tracking contracts, subscriptions, or tasks in a Google Sheet.

Stop Chasing Deadlines. Let the Sheet Email You.

Set a date, pick a recipient, choose how many days warning you want. Google Sheets does the rest — no daily checking, no missed renewals, no Monday-morning reminder emails.

Features

No coding knowledge needed. The script is pre-written — you just run it once and set a daily trigger. Setup takes under five minutes.

🔔

Reminders go out automatically

Attach a trigger once. After that, the sheet checks deadlines daily and sends emails without you touching it — even while you're out of office.

⚙️

Configure per row

Each row sets its own recipient, subject line, and days-before value. One sheet can send reminders to your entire team, each on the right schedule.

📋

Pre-written script, no coding required

The Google Apps Script is included and ready to run. You set the trigger in two clicks. Nothing to write, nothing to debug.

📅

Works with any deadline type

Contracts, certifications, subscriptions, project milestones, client follow-ups — anything with a date column gets the same automatic alerting.

How It Works

Up and running in minutes.

1
📂

Copy the template to your Drive

Make a copy to your Google Drive. Your data stays private in your own account — nothing leaves Google's infrastructure.

2
✏️

Add your deadlines

Fill in the columns: Deadline Date, Owner Email, Subject Line, Days Before Alert. Each row is independent — different owners, different timing.

3

Set the trigger and walk away

Open Apps Script (one click from the Extensions menu), run the setup function, and choose 'daily.' From that point on, alerts go out automatically from your Gmail.

Product Showcase

See it in Action

Demo video coming soon

Perfect For

See yourself here? This template was built for you.

📝

Contract renewal alerts

Get notified 30, 14, and 7 days before any contract expires. Send alerts to the account owner, not a shared inbox nobody reads.

🏅

Employee certification expiry

Track certifications, licences, and compliance training in one sheet. Alert the employee and their manager before anything lapses.

🎯

Project milestone reminders

Give project leads and clients advance notice of deliverable dates — without building a full project management system.

🔄

SaaS and subscription renewals

Track every software renewal date in one place. Alert the budget owner before auto-renewal fires so there are no surprise charges.

🤝

Client follow-up sequences

Log the date of each client touchpoint and get reminded when it's time to check in — no CRM required for smaller pipelines.

Simple Pricing

One payment. Lifetime access. No subscriptions.

$0
USD · One-time payment
Instant download
Lifetime updates included
Documentation & setup guide
No coding knowledge needed. The script is pre-written — you just run it once and set a daily trigger. Setup takes under five minutes.
Copy to My Google Drive — Free

Secure checkout via LemonSqueezy

Need multi-recipient alerts, Slack notifications, or a branded email layout?

We build custom deadline automation workflows for teams that have outgrown the basic template — multi-channel alerts, conditional logic, CRM sync, and more.

Get in Touch

Frequently Asked Questions

Everything you need to know about this template

Does this work with the free version of Google Sheets?

Yes. The template uses Google Apps Script, which is included with every Google account at no charge — personal Gmail and Google Workspace both work.

Do I need to know how to code?

No. The script is already written and included in the template. You run one setup function (one click), set a daily trigger, and it handles the rest. You never need to open the code.

Can I send reminders to different people for different rows?

Yes — each row has its own recipient email column. One sheet can alert your whole team, each person receiving only their relevant reminders.

What happens if a deadline passes without being actioned?

The script marks alerted rows with a 'Sent' status to avoid duplicate emails. You can reset the status manually to re-send an alert, or add a second alert threshold (e.g. 7 days and 1 day) as separate rows.

Can I use this with Google Workspace business accounts?

Yes. The template works on all Google Workspace tiers. If your organisation has Apps Script disabled by IT policy, contact your admin to enable it for this use case.